Andra AP fonden Decreases Holdings in Expedia Group, Inc. $EXPE

Andra AP fonden trimmed its holdings in shares of Expedia Group, Inc. (NASDAQ:EXPEFree Report) by 36.7%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 66,873 shares of the online travel company’s stock after selling 38,827 shares during the quarter. Andra AP fonden’s holdings in Expedia Group were worth $15,440,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Expedia Group (NASDAQ:EXPEG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, May 7th. The online travel company reported $1.96 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.41 by $0.55. The firm had revenue of $3.43 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$3.35 billion. Expedia Group had a return on equity of 84.33% and a net margin of 9.81%.The business’s revenue was up 14.7%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ned $0.40 EPS. Equities research analysts anticipate that Expedia Group, Inc. will post 16.98 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Expedia Group Company Profile

(Free Report)

Expedia Group (NASDAQ: EXPE) is a global travel technology company that operates an online marketplace connecting consumers, travel suppliers and third‑party partners. The company’s platform enables search, comparison and booking of travel products and services, including hotels, airline tickets, vacation rentals, car rentals, cruises and packaged travel. Its portfolio comprises consumer-facing travel brands as well as corporate travel solutions and technology services that serve both leisure and business travelers.

Key offerings include consumer booking platforms and mobile apps that aggregate inventory from hotels, vacation rental managers, airlines and car rental companies, alongside ancillary travel services such as trip insurance and activities.
